bench-analyzer

An agent that examines JSONL benchmark results for Lumen, a local semantic code-search tool. JSONL is a text format with one JSON record per line.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to review Lumen benchmark output and produce recommendations for improving search quality.
Why use it?
It helps identify whether problems come from how code is divided into searchable pieces or from the search results themselves.
